0

Попытка получить живую панель состояния моих ворот (ON, OFF)Как получить данные от узла-RED/Octoblu к власти BI

формат JSON моей полезной нагрузки

"msg": { 
     "time_on": 1437773972742, 
     "time_off": 1437773974231, 
} 

У кого-нибудь есть опыт в том, как отправлять состояния во власть bi без использования Azure Stream Analytics или Event Hub?

Edit: Попытки отправить два JSon пакетов от узла-красного к мощности BI, чтобы получить живые обновления на моей приборной панели

+0

Непонятно, что вы здесь делаете. Пожалуйста, добавьте более подробную информацию о том, что вы уже пробовали – hardillb

+0

@hardillb помогает? – Nikola

ответ

0

Если вы хотите использовать поток Analytics вам нужно будет выравниваться свойствами, делая выбор сообщения. time_on, msg.time_off FROM Input.

Если вы не хотите использовать Stream Analytics, вам придется либо нажимать данные на один из источников, из которых Power BI может периодически извлекать такие данные, как SQL Azure (Примечание: это не будет в реальном времени) или интегрировать с API-интерфейсом Power BI, просматривая здесь ресурсы: http://dev.powerbi.com.

Ziv.

+0

hey thx. я смотрю раздел powerbi dev, но я новичок в программном обеспечении, db и json. Можете ли вы подробно рассказать о том, как я могу отправить его из Node-RED в power BI. – Nikola

+0

Я, к сожалению, не знаю Node-RED и не могу предоставить образец, но, надеюсь, кто-то еще в сообществе может помочь ... –

0

Я также не знаю Node-RED; но здесь довольно хорошие образцы: https://github.com/PowerBI. Вы также можете использовать нашу консоль API (http://docs.powerbi.apiary.io/), чтобы играть с API. Консоль может генерировать код для вас в общих языков, таких как JavaScript, Ruby, Python, C# и т.д.

Посмотрите Создать Dataset: http://docs.powerbi.apiary.io/#reference/datasets/datasets-collection/create-a-dataset

и добавить строки в таблицу: http://docs.powerbi.apiary.io/#reference/datasets/table-rows/add-rows-to-a-table-in-a-dataset

HTH , Lukasz